It can be installed directly, over pywood or sheetrock, or can be purchased already laminated on plywood or sheetrock of different thicknesses. A plywood or sheetrock backing is more durable than just FRP which would be good in a shop. You can get the seam strips, seal them, etc. for a washable surface.

There is also paperless sheetrock now available and being used widely if you are really worried about mold. Molds need a cellulose source (which paper is) to grow. The paperless still has a covering for stability like normal sheetrock but is is a non-cellulose covering.

Hardi-panel, which is a concrete based siding, would be a good choice too. It is very durable.
